WILMA’s Leadership Institute, an annual nine-month program, gives area women the opportunity to learn from leaders in the region, visit a range of local companies, and serve as each other’s personal board of directors. The program is part of the WILMA Leadership Initiative, created to empower women to lead with confidence and purpose. Meet institute member KIPPY BATUYIOS.


Kippy Batuyios

Title:  Principal Instructional Designer

Company:  nCino

How long have you been with your current employer?  6 years

Alma Mater:  University of North Carolina Wilmington, Cameron School of Business

Prior career experience: I began my career processing mortgages at Wells Fargo before transitioning to underwriting, then moved into the software industry as a customer success manager. As the company grew, I had the opportunity to pivot to customer training and have now been in the product enablement field for 12 years. I also previously ran a local food blog that connected me with Wilmington’s culinary community and was featured in local media.

Current job responsibilities: I design scalable technical product enablement programs for customers, partners, and employees while serving as team lead and mentor for other instructional designers in the product space.

Hobbies: Outside of work, my hobbies mostly center around food! I’m an enthusiastic home cook who loves exploring Wilmignton’s food scene with my husband, two kids, and my Westie, Wilkie.
